Lyle Robert Peck, 94, passed away at his home in Sublimity, Oregon on October 28, 2016.
Lyle was born October 26, 1922 on a farm in Muscatine, Iowa. He was the youngest of 3 boys born to David George Peck and Ollie Annie Rae Andreas. The family moved to Idaho when Lyle was a teenager and he graduated from the Thatcher High School.
He moved to Pocatello, Idaho where he worked for the Union Pacific Railroad. In June 1941 he married Alta Emma Rasmussen McCann and became step-father to Donna, Glennys and Keith.
They moved to San Pedro, California where Lyle worked in the ship yards. A veteran of WWII, he served in the Philippine Islands with the 32nd Infantry Division. After his discharge from the Army, he was employed by Los Angeles County, retiring in May 1975.
He and Alta moved to Grace, Idaho following his retirement. He served on the Grace City Council for 10 years. He was also actively involved at the Senior Center in Soda Springs for awhile. Lyle was a member of the VFW and American Legion.
Alta passed away and he married Anna Marie Peirano Kibbie (who was also active at the senior Center) on August 17, 1994 and they made their home in Soda Springs, Idaho. They enjoyed traveling on many memorable trips and cruises. Lyle was a wonderful gardener, fisherman and outdoorsman.
Lyle was preceded in death by his first wife Alta, his parents, brothers Dale and Dean, step-daughters Donna and Glennys and step-son Keith. He is survived by his wife Anna, step-son John Bosshardt (Diana) of Lake Oswego, Oregon; step-daughter-in-law Judy McCann and family and many nieces and nephews.
